Air Stagnation Advisory
Issued:
1:48 PM PST
Dec.
8,
2019
–
National Weather Service
... Air stagnation advisory remains in effect until noon PST
Tuesday below 1500 feet...
* what... stagnant air may lead to poor air quality at times.
* Where... interior southwest Washington and interior northwest
Oregon for areas below 1500 feet.
* When... until noon PST Tuesday. Strong inversions will develop
Sunday night and continue through at least Tuesday morning
across the area.
* Impacts... poor air quality may cause issues for people with
respiratory problems.
Precautionary/preparedness actions...
People with respiratory illness should follow their physician's
advice for dealing with high levels of air pollution during
periods of stagnant air.
State air quality agencies highly recommend that no outdoor
burning occur and that residential wood burning devices be
limited as much as possible. According to state air quality
agencies, prolonged periods of stagnant air can hold pollutants
close to the ground where people live and breathe. Check with
your local burn agency for any current restrictions in your area.
